McGrady scratched from Rockets' lineup tonight
MRI reveals no knee injury for veteran guard
By JONATHAN FEIGEN Copyright 2009 Houston Chronicle
Feb. 11, 2009, 6:35PM
Tracy McGrady has missed 16 games this season while trying to rehabilitate his knee after last May’s surgery.
Rockets guard Tracy McGrady has been ruled out of tonight’s game against the Sacramento Kings because of on-going problems with his left knee.
McGrady underwent an MRI examination that revealed no knee injury or other changes since previous tests and diagnoses, the Rockets announced Wednesday. The Rockets said holding him out of tonight's game was a "precautionary measure."
McGrady has missed 16 games this season while trying to rehabilitate his knee after last May’s surgery. He played in seven of eight games since returning from two weeks of conditioning, missing one with a sprained ankle. He made 1 of 9 shots Monday in the loss in Milwaukee.
McGrady is averaging 15.6 points per game, making a career-low 38.8 percent of his shots.
